How Do Easy Regional Storms Impact Flight Delays?

Easy regional storms can significantly affect flight schedules, leading to ripple delays across multiple flights. These disruptions can occur due to various factors, such as limited visibility and challenges in landing and takeoff patterns. Additionally, as airlines make adjustments to avoid affected areas, travelers may find themselves facing unexpected itinerary changes.

How Do Delay Alerts Work in Flight Tracking Apps?

Delay alerts from flight tracking applications notify users of changes in their flight status, providing critical information faster than traditional airline apps. For those traveling when storms are forecasted, these alerts can help in real-time decision-making—enabling users to reschedule or alter plans before reaching the airport.

How Do Weather Overlays Enhance Visibility for Travelers?

Weather overlays in flight tracking applications enhance users’ ability to perceive storm conditions. By visually representing weather data on flight maps, travelers gain a clearer understanding of potential delays or cancellations, facilitating proactive adjustments to their travel plans. This visual approach supports better strategic planning around flight schedules.
